Paris Fashion Week got a dose of Zendaya on Monday.

The actress turned up to the star-studded runway presentation for Louis Vuitton in the City of Lights wearing a daring white dress with double zippers. The plunging gown featured a top zipper that was pulled down to her midriff, while the bottom accent was zipped open to her mid thigh. She paired the look with stilettos to match, minimal Bulgari jewelry (including mini hoop earrings, gold bangles and a ring) and her hair parted down the middle. She attended the womenswear spring/summer 2024 show with an entourage that included longtime stylist and close friend Law Roach.

Zendaya debuted as a house ambassador for Louis Vuitton in April as part of a campaign to launch the Capucines bag. The fall season was shaping up to be a high-profile run for the actress, who had back-to-back releases set to hit the big screen in Luca Guadagnino’s Challengers and Denis Villeneuve’s Dune sequel. However, due to the SAG-AFTRA strike, those movies got pushed to 2024.

Monday’s presentation from creative director Nicolas Ghesquière proved to be a starry affair filled with Oscar winners, filmmakers, international pop stars and European fashionistas. Among those in attendance were Cate Blanchett, Léa Seydoux, Ana de Armas, Regina King, Alicia Vikander, Ava DuVernay, Jennifer Connelly and Paul Bettany, Cynthia Erivo, Phoebe Dynevor, Gemma Chan, Chloë Grace Moretz, Jaden Smith, Venus Williams, Jurnee Smollett, Emma Chamberlain, Robyn, Felix, New Jeans member Hyein, and Haim members Este, Danielle and Alana Haim.

Also making the rounds was Pharrell Williams, who took over as men’s creative director for Louis Vuitton this year. For today’s show, James Chinlund handled production design and per the house, it was designed to evoke Louis Vuitton’s “spirit of travel.” Chinlund reimagined the space as a hot air balloon draped in sails created by Penique Productions “beckoning guests to immerse in the warm summer light cast across the set.”
